#include "tableReader.H"
// * * * * * * * * * * * * * * Static Data Members * * * * * * * * * * * * * //
template
Foam::autoPtr> Foam::tableReader::New
(
const dictionary& spec
)
{
const word readerType = spec.lookupOrDefault
(
"readerType",
"openFoam"
);
typename dictionaryConstructorTable::iterator cstrIter =
dictionaryConstructorTablePtr_
->find(readerType);
if (!cstrIter.found())
{
FatalErrorInFunction
<< "Unknown reader type " << readerType
<< nl << nl
<< "Valid reader types : " << nl
<< dictionaryConstructorTablePtr_->sortedToc()
<< exit(FatalError);
}
return autoPtr>(cstrIter()(spec));
}
// * * * * * * * * * * * * * * * * Constructors * * * * * * * * * * * * * * //
template
Foam::tableReader::tableReader(const dictionary&)
{}
// * * * * * * * * * * * * * * * * Destructor * * * * * * * * * * * * * * * //
template
Foam::tableReader::~tableReader()
{}
// * * * * * * * * * * * * * * * Member Functions * * * * * * * * * * * * * //
template
void Foam::tableReader::write(Ostream& os) const
{
if (this->type() != "openFoam")
{
os.writeKeyword("readerType")
<< this->type() << token::END_STATEMENT << nl;
}
}
